I'm using MM2004 with regions 3-8 currently and wondered if there is anyway of entering a gridref and getting the map to display that location...

If you create a Mark (waypoint) anywhere on your map and then "right-click" on its base to get a pop-up memu. Select Properties... and edit the Position.

The Mark will then show at the new location. Thumbs Up

You have be careful to enter the NGR in EXACTLY the right format or Memory Map corrupts it. If you enter AB 123 456 then Memory Map incorrectly changes it to AB 00123 00456. I have complained to them about this but they just sent me a link to a file about NGR's. I suggested that their software writers read it!

Even Autoroute can accept any format of NGR and correctly interpret it.

I have all UK in Memory Map 2003 but I won't be buying 2004 or any more of their products because of this.

When youhave entered the NGR then it is usually best to lock it before clicking on "View" to take you that position.
